The Basics of Card Game Play

At its core, a card game involves the use of a deck of playing cards to engage in a series of competitive or cooperative actions. The most common deck consists of 52 cards, divided into four suits: hearts, diamonds, clubs, and spades. Each suit contains 13 cards, ranging from Ace to King, with unique numerical and symbolic values. The gameplay revolves around the distribution and comparison of these cards according to the specific rules of the game.

One of the most fundamental aspects of card game play is understanding the ranking of the cards. In most games, the Ace holds the highest rank, followed by King, Queen, Jack, and then the numbered cards from 10 down to 2. However, in some games, especially those involving trick-taking, the Ace can also be the lowest card, depending on the game's objective. Knowing the value of each card is crucial for making informed decisions during gameplay.

Another essential element is the concept of betting or placing bets. In games like Poker or Blackjack, players must decide whether to bet higher, lower, or not at all based on their hand's strength and the actions of other players. Effective betting strategies can significantly influence the outcome of the game, making it a key component of card game play.

The Role of Psychology in Card Game Play

Psychology plays a pivotal role in card game play, often more so than the actual skill or knowledge of the game. Players must read their opponents, anticipate their moves, and adapt their strategies in real-time. This requires a combination of observation skills, intuition, and the ability to read both your own emotions and those of others.

One of the most common psychological tactics in card games is "reading the table." This involves observing the betting patterns, body language, and general demeanor of other players to infer their intentions and potential strategies. For example, a player who frequently raises their bets in certain situations may be bluffing, while a player who consistently folds in specific ranges may be holding a weaker hand.

Another important aspect of psychological play is the ability to manage your own emotions. Card games can be emotionally taxing, with high stakes and the uncertainty of outcomes creating a lot of stress. Players must learn to stay calm, focused, and disciplined, even in the face of pressure. Techniques such as deep breathing, mindfulness, and positive visualization can help you maintain your composure and make more rational decisions.
